Age Discrimination – Sometimes It’s Not About the Law and Just About Fairness

Sometimes legal folk (myself included) get bogged down about the technical elements of the law.  But when you get right down to it, I think a common sense approach guides our decisions pretty well.

This story reminded me of that.  Navy Seal (from Tucson) was rejected from a Fire Department job because of his age – 37.  This, even though he scored among the highest on the tests and is in great shape.  But most importantly, he served our country faithfully and honorably.  I know there are rules to “get around” giving him the job.  Seriously though – why wouldn’t; why shouldn’t we do the right thing here!

Thankfully, others agree and Fire Departments across the country are encouraging him to join them!
